Title: Establishes Family Bereavement Leave

Vote Smart's Synopsis:

Vote to pass a bill that establishes family bereavement leave.

Highlights:

  • Requires that employers provide at least 2 weeks of unpaid bereavement leave for the death of a family member or a miscarriage (Sec. 2).

  • Requires that the employee provide the employer with 48 hours’ notice if taking bereavement leave (Sec. 2).

  • Requires that employers provide up to 6 weeks of unpaid leave for the death of 2 family members in a 12-month period (Sec. 2).
